Baclofen and gabapentin/neurontin/lyrica address withdrawal symptoms (somehow) - they are strong sedatives and mood stabilizers. Clonodine lowers blood pressure, and high BP is a direct cause of a lot of the physical symptoms of withdrawal (hot/cold flashes, general anxiety, etc.)
